        Hi,

        The number one question at the minute is hotels, B&B, motels, etc etc. So we wanted to get some information out to you ASAP. So here it goes.

        1. Generator Hostels: Sometimes full of partiers, but we've had friends + family stay there.They said it was clean and fine (they had a private room)https://generatorhostels.com/en/destinations/berlin/
        1. Generator Prenzlauer Berg - https://generatorhostels.com/…/dest…/berlin/prenzlauer-berg/ (relatively convenient, on ring to Gesundbrunnen then one stop on U8 to Pankstr)

        2. Generator Hostel Berlin Mitte -https://generatorhostels.com/en/destinations/berlin/mitte/ (also relatively convenient.)

        3. Circus Hostel - https://www.circus-berlin.de/hostel/ - A TroikaTronix team member stayed here before and said it was good (very convenient, onU8)

        4. Die Fabrik Hostel - https://diefabrik.com/1-1-home.html – A friend has stayed here a few times. Not very convenient for our thing though.

        5. Ibis Berlin - http://www.accorhotels.com/ The Ibis hotels… cheap, clean, fine. The budget one at Alex, which would of course be very convenient shows 56€ per night right now.

        6. And always remember to check out: Kayak.com

        Some of you may be aware of a service called Airbnb. Well, The situation here in Berlin is a bit tricky. New legislation was recently passed to prevent folks from exploiting Air BnB to the point that regular Berliners are priced out of affordable housing. This just happened so folks are still figuring out what the legislation actually means + in the meantime short term rentals have gone a bit quiet.

        So PLEASE be cautious OR have a back-up plan if you choose to use AirBNB.

        For reference here is a link to the venue so you can search for accommodation near by:

        https://goo.gl/maps/hMEFGkmr8by

            Just to clarify the AirBnB situation in Berlin at the moment. The new legislation only effects people who rent out an entire apartment. There are plenty of spare rooms and sofabeds for rent on AirBnB that are still legit, and usually cheaper than many other options.
